Sevier County Electric System: At a Glance
The Sevier County Electric System, commonly known as SCES, stands as a pillar of public service in East Tennessee. As a nonprofit, public utility company, its fundamental purpose is not driven by shareholder profits but by the core mission to provide its customers with reliable electricity. This distinction is crucial, as it means SCES operates with the community's best interests at heart, focusing on service quality, affordability, and long-term infrastructure investment. This commitment ensures that the power supply remains stable and accessible to all who depend on it.
Serving a substantial customer base, SCES provides electricity for over 60,000 customers across both Sevier and Blount counties. This extensive coverage area underscores the significant responsibility SCES bears in powering homes, businesses, and public facilities throughout a dynamic and growing region. From the bustling tourist hubs of Sevierville and Pigeon Forge to the quieter residential areas, the consistent flow of electricity from Sevier County Electric is the lifeblood of daily operations and economic activity. The scale of their operations highlights their critical role in regional development and stability.
